Bridal Veil Falls is a breathtaking 607-foot waterfall in Provo Canyon, Utah that attracts visitors from near and far. Along with being the tallest waterfall in Utah, the hike leading up to it is also impressive.

Since the 1.4-mile trail heading to the waterfall is rated easy, Bridal Veil Falls is a great destination for a day trip that everyone in your family can enjoy together. Due to weather conditions, it’s best to visit the trail between May and September. However, since the hike is popular, try to visit during a less crowded time of day.
